Результаты поиска по запросу "doubly-linked-list"
Временная сложность удаления узла в одно- и двусвязных списках
Почему временная сложность удаления узла в двусвязных списках (O (1)) быстрее, чем удаление узлов в односвязных списках (O (n))?
Реализация двусвязного списка с указателями C ++
В настоящее время я учу себя C ++ и пытаюсь реализовать двусвязный список в C ++, используя указатели, которые частично завершены. Я знаю, что код в настоящее время не может справиться с висячими узлами или ошибками вывода, оба из которых я буду ...
Быстрая сортировка по двусвязному списку
Я хочу реализовать алгоритм быстрой сортировки в синхронизированном двусвязном списке. Я даю функции «разбиение» левую и правую границу, затем она начинает искать более низкие значения с левой стороны и помещает большие с правой стороны. Это ...
Как можно выполнить бинарный поиск по двусвязному списку за O (n) раз?
Я слышал, что можно реализовать бинарный поиск по двусвязному списку за O (n) раз. Доступ к случайному элементу двусвязного списка занимает O (n) времени, а двоичный поиск обращается к O (log n) различным элементам, поэтому разве время выполнения ...
Как можно выполнить бинарный поиск по двусвязному списку за O (n) раз?
Я слышал, что этоВозможно реализовать бинарный поиск по двусвязному списку за O (n) раз. Доступ к случайному элементу двусвязного списка занимает O (n) време...
Реализация двусвязного списка с указателями C ++
В настоящее время я учу себя C ++ и пытаюсь реализовать двусвязный список в C ++, используя указатели, которые частично завершены. Я знаю, что код в настояще...
Поменяйте местами элементы в двусвязном списке по их индексам в массиве поддержки
У меня есть массив объектов следующего типа:
Страница 1 из 2